  3. Seriously.. was that healer nature? if so.. you would be amazed what damage can be done with swarm.. I am a 100% legit player and am completely dumbfounded by the damage I put out with it.
    Swarm counts as a pet so it's damage is not penalized by the player being in healer mode, also as it is a pet its damage out is based on cr.. pretty odd imo. but nevertheless it does crazy damage on my healer. I have a couple of scoreboards I could show you too xD
